Norway represents one of the most advanced and consolidated retail markets globally. Dominated by major conglomerates such as NorgesGruppen, Coop Norge, and REMA 1000, the region prioritizes operating efficiency, high-end design, and exceptional checkout ergonomics. High domestic labor costs necessitate that checkout front-ends perform with maximum throughput and minimum downtime.
Additionally, the Norwegian retail market is strictly regulated by safety and health authorities (Arbeidstilsynet). Cashier counters must be designed with physical well-being in mind—complying with modern ergonomic heights, automated conveyor safety parameters, and integrated cash handling structures such as BankAxept card payment systems and Vipps mobile integrations.
